Evaluating Peptide TB-500 & AIO Peptide : Effects & Treatments

While both Peptide TB-500 and AIO Peptide are attracting interest for their purported regenerative properties, they work through somewhat separate mechanisms. TB 500 , a fragment of thymosin beta-4, is primarily understood to encourage tissue repair , particularly in ligaments. However, The AIO compound is a multifaceted blend that often includes various small protein chains, meant to offer a more holistic approach to recovery . As a result, while Peptide TB-500 might be favored for focused injuries like ligament tears, AIO Peptide may be a preferable choice when addressing several factors impacting overall athletic function .

Introductory Guide to AIO Peptides: Understanding the Types

AIO peptides, or All-In-One peptides, are showing up as increasingly widespread in skincare for their potential to address multiple signs of aging. But with so many different kinds around, it can feel overwhelming to know where to begin . This simple guide will explain the main categories. Generally, AIO peptides combine multiple peptide sequences designed to work synergistically for a broader effect. These can be broadly grouped into types relating to collagen production (like Matrixyl), skin elasticity (such as Snap-8), pigmentation fading , and wrinkle minimizing.


  • Collagen-Boosting: These peptides stimulate the creation of collagen, a vital protein for skin structure.
  • Elasticity-Enhancing: Designed to improve skin's bounce and firmness – reducing the appearance of sagging.
  • Pigmentation-Targeting: Help to even out uneven skin tone and diminish dark spots.
  • Wrinkle-Reducing: Act on facial movements to help smooth wrinkles.

Note that formulations will often blend several of these peptide types for a more complete approach to skincare. Doing your research is essential when selecting products.
